Title :
Analysis of high-speed VLSI interconnects using the asymptotic waveform evaluation technique

Abstract :
A generalization of the asymptotic waveform evaluation method to handle interconnect models which contain distributed elements is described. As an example, analysis of lossy coupled transmission lines is considered. The method is useful for both delay and crosstalk estimation.<>
